GVS Supported Cellulose Acetate Membranes
Description
- Exceptionally strong, Triton™-free, low protein-binding cellulose acetate impregnated onto nonwoven support
- Hydrophilic with unequaled dimensional and wet strength — eliminate filter cracking and tearing under pressure
- Fast flow, high throughput, low protein/nucleic acid binding
- Withstand temperatures to 180°C (356°F); autoclavable
- Mean thickness: 150μm
- White with plain surface; come in dispenser packs of 25 or 100
Protein and enzyme filtrations, tissue culture media preparation, biological/pharmaceutical solution filtration, sterility tests.
